Largo is the third largest city in Pinellas County, Florida, United States, and the fourth largest in the Tampa Bay area. As of the 2020 census, the city had a population of 82,485, [4] up from 77,648 in 2010. The spacious park of 162 acres offers a variety of activities in teh middle of busy Largo, Florida.
